I saw that a while ago - I actually loved it, especially considering how much emotion she puts into it. Her vocals strain a bit, but you kind of have to give her some consideration because she had vocal surgery a bit before that time if I recall correctly. Her voice has been affected by it since, but it hasn't stopped her from performing or releasing new material.
Then again I might be biased because I love and respect her work for the most part.
She's actually covering Tori Amos' version of the song, so its drastically different from the Nirvana rendition if referencing that as a comparison.

@Ken, I think it's because "Know Your Enemy" was the song they decided to release for the first single, if I recall. They're pushing it pretty heavily on the radio stations where I am too, and since their album just came out this past week, they're trying to push the single as much as they can to go through the album. I ran errands quite a few times this week, I heard that song at least a handful of times.
I think there are a lot of good songs on their album so far (I've heard about 5 songs), so it's hard to say whether or not "Know Your Enemy" was the best to choose for their singles. I think they're playing it a lot since they just released their album not long ago.
